Objectives
Narrative objectives1 To assess the efficacy of high resolution scannning LASER ophthalmoscope (SLO) in detecting macular blood flow alteration induced by glaucoma topical drugs.
To assess the correlation among retinal blood flow parameters determined by high resolution SLO, laser speckle flowgraphy (LSFG), and optical coherence tomography (OCT).

Assessment
Primary outcomes Blood flow rate in macular capillaries before and at 7days, 1 and 3months after starting topical anti-glaucoma medications
Key secondary outcomes Diameter of macular capillaries before and at 7days, 1 and 3months after starting topical anti-glaucoma medications

Intervention
No. of arms 1
Purpose of intervention Diagnosis
Type of intervention
Device,equipment
Interventions/Control_1 To take images of the human ocular fundus using scannning LASER ophthalmoscope (SLO), laser speckle flowgraphy (LSFG), and optical coherence tomography (OCT) before and at 7days, 1 and 3months after starting topical anti-glaucoma medications.

Eligibility
Age-lower limit
20 years-old <=
Age-upper limit

Not applicable
Gender Male and Female
Key inclusion criteria Patient
1) Male or female older than 20 years-old
2) patients with glaucoma or ocular hypertension
3) Subjects who sign an informed consent form to participate in the clinical study
Key exclusion criteria 1) Having any side-effects (hypersensitivity, rised intraocular pressure etc.) against mydriatics
2) Revealed narrow angle by slit-lamp examination
3) When a doctor accepted the middle-class above-mentioned cataract
4) Subjects who a doctor in attendance declares ineligible for any reason
Target sample size 160
